
As the shock reverberated over the assassination of conservative activist Charlie Kirk, the sports community found a way to honor him Wednesday night.
From tributes, prayers, and posted messages, the New York Yankees and others in the sports world reacted to the death of the 31-year-old founder of Turning Point USA, who was a Chicago Cubs fan and was recently at a game at Wrigley Field.
